Little Sunshine by Bloham
This is not just the first game project for the LDGame Jam but also the first game I ever release and the first game I showed to the public, made entirely by myself! The theme was Keep it alive. You have to nourish the little sunshine with water and sunlight while defending against hordes of evil bugs! Stay alive for two minutes and win the ultimate price :)
It was a fantastic experience creating this game for the last 48 hours! I know that this game is not perfect and I know so many things to improve. Still, I would love to hear your opinion on it and recommendations to improve "little sunshine" enjoy playing!
